Subject: Re: [PATCH] media: verisilicon: AV1: Be more fexible on postproc capabilities
Date: Mon, 6 May 2024 16:38:53 +0200 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<c747a5e6-e3f2-4bea-87e2-92b71501db9a@collabora.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<ebbe249f-bce6-4e81-969f-c63ab4b063f3@collabora.com>
Le 05/04/2024 à 10:17, Benjamin Gaignard a écrit :
>
> Le 04/04/2024 à 19:59, Nicolas Dufresne a écrit :
>> Hi,
>>
>> Le jeudi 28 mars 2024 à 10:34 +0100, Benjamin Gaignard a écrit :
>>> RK3588 post-processor block is able to convert 10 bits streams
>>> into 8 bits pixels format.
>> Does it come with any HDR to SDR capabilities ? cause stripping off 2
>> bits means
>> that tone mapping will cause a lot of banding as it won't have the
>> expected
>> precision. I'm simply trying to make up the big portrait so we don't
>> just offer
>> yet another foot gun. But perhaps its fine to offer this, its just
>> that we don't
>> have a mechanism to report which pixel format in the selection will
>> cause data
>> lost.
>
> No it just to enable post-processor capabilities like we have already
> for G2/HEVC.
> Since it is a post-processor pixel format it will be enumerated after
> V4L2_PIX_FMT_NV15_4L4
> so it will update to userland to decide to use it or not.
